The Majors: Strategies for the Energy Transition
Report summary
Energy Transition is on its way. Since South Korea government announced its 2050 carbon neutrality goal last October, oil and gas majors have been challenged for their high emission business portfolio. How are Big Oils moving towards net-zero emission? What key technologies will help them out? What are the risks and opportunities? In the webinar, we discussed the Majors’ energy transition strategy, focusing on CCUS and hydrogen.
